(Montreal) A bar in the Verdun borough of Montreal was targeted by a second arson attack in four days on the night of Monday to Tuesday.

According to the Montreal City Police Service (SPVM), around 3:30 a.m. Tuesday, a suspect smashed a window on the front of the business located on Wellington Street to throw incendiary objects inside.

There was an initial fire, but the flames went out on their own. There was no one inside, so no one was injured in the incident. The damage would be minor.

The SPVM has, however, opened an investigation, since the same licensed establishment was the target of a similar event last weekend.

The SPVM arson module will be responsible for the investigation. Its members will go to the site on Tuesday morning to assess the scene and try to establish the circumstances surrounding this incident.
